As the Maintenance Supervisor you would lead a maintenance department, directly working with the team to perform maintenance functions as well as ensuring inventory needs are maintained.
Duties/Responsibilities
- Track maintenance employees' performance and perform periodic reviews.
- Advise any department and/or site-specific needs for capital expenditure on requests.
- Able to work alone on complex tasks and provide adequate communication to all related parties.
- Use CMMS software to track inventory and create, modify, and schedule tasks for maintenance personnel.
- Maintain appropriate mean time to repair and accurate estimates of work completion time.
- Work with contractors to schedule services such as press, crane, air compressor maintenance.
- Coordinate work with production scheduling when possible.
- Perform in compliance with best practices, company standards, and customer specifications.
- Maintain a clean and safe department, including periodic testing for PPE, LOTO, etc.
- Training employees on proper Machine maintenance
Skills/Qualifications
- 4 or more years' experience in Industrial Maintenance
- 2 or more years' experience in Supervision or Managment in an industrial setting.
- Proficient in diagnosing and repairing electrical and PLC controls as well as mechanical, hydraulic, and pneumatic systems.
- Strong communications skills and ability to work together while leading a team.
- Knowledge of safety standards and regulations.
- Computer and mathematical skills.
- Able to lift 50 lbs. regularly and stand, climb, kneel, bend, and lift for up to 10 hours per day.
- High School Diploma or GED.
